More from my previous link on the use of financial resources in this campaign
On top of that, Obama has nearly 500 paid organizers in Florida — about 10 times as many as McCain — and counts more than 230,000 volunteers.
The rolling average of the latest Florida polls compiled by RealClearPolitics.com shows Obama leading by 3.3 percentage points, and some Democratic strategists think their voter mobilization is so strong they can win if they head into Election Day lagging McCain by a point or two.
"This is the best field organization put together at least since the 1976 Carter campaign,'' said Jon Ausman, a Democratic National Committee member from Tallahassee. "The early voting is going so heavily in our direction it's going to way offset the losses we normally suffer in the absentee ballots."
